Uncertainty and Sensitivity Analysis for policy decision making
An introductory guide
The European Commission is committed to transparent and evidence based policy making throughout the policy cycle. Simulation models are increasingly used in impact assessments to provide support to policy makers across a wide range of policy areas. To ensure model quality in support to policy, understanding and communicating uncertainty in model outputs is essential. In modelling, accounting for uncertainties and identifying its most important sources is an inherent issue. Uncertainty and sensitivity analysis should be systematically performed in modelling activities in support to policy making. This report aims at highlighting the added value that uncertainty and sensitivity analysis can bring to modelling activities to inform policy makers, and presents a specific software that has been developed within the Commission to help modellers and analysts.
